About N'-(3,5-dimethoxyphenyl)-N-methyl-N'-[3-[1-(oxan-4-ylmethyl)pyrazol-4-yl]quinoxalin-6-yl]ethane-1,2-diamine;hydrochloride

N'-(3,5-dimethoxyphenyl)-N-methyl-N'-[3-[1-(oxan-4-ylmethyl)pyrazol-4-yl]quinoxalin-6-yl]ethane-1,2-diamine;hydrochloride (PubChem CID 134138981) has the molecular formula C28H35ClN6O3 and a molecular weight of 539.08 g/mol. Its IUPAC name is N'-(3,5-dimethoxyphenyl)-N-methyl-N'-[3-[1-(oxan-4-ylmethyl)pyrazol-4-yl]quinoxalin-6-yl]ethane-1,2-diamine;hydrochloride.
